    Just a tip though- before you shave, since you've said you never did it before, trim with a scissors first, and then shave. I usually just use plain soap when I shave, because you'll want to use something. I don't use shaving creams down there, because I do not want to risk getting any sort of infection (in case it gets inside somwhere). Thats why I use plain soap, it will help with razor burn. And a warning- once it starts to grow back (about 2 days to a week) its going to get itchy and you might get some red bumps (ingrown hairs). This is all completely normal!
